I tried for a Cap One Venture a year ago, and was turned down:
- too many recent apps (didn't specifically say 24 months, that I can recall)
- no revolving credit activity (a fair cop -- I've not had any loans in several years)
- not enough income for expenses (silly; I'm retired, so my "income" is precisely what I need it to be)
For what it's worth I was 11/24, 6/12. I tried calling for reconsideration, but they don't seem to have a number for that per se.
